Transaction 7146ba2e30fcaef7016002721551e71a093e00eb6b23db3afa564747e9016ee6

2 Input
2 Outputs
  • 7146ba2e30fcaef7016002721551e71a093e00eb6b23db3afa564747e9016ee6:0
  • value  700000000
    address  112n6hnWXTGtNcbYTv6H9JRFWfmLPeSo67
  • 7146ba2e30fcaef7016002721551e71a093e00eb6b23db3afa564747e9016ee6:1
  • value  99997902
    address  14bMjM2oZB7diazH6HRq7qDVV2nphAT7KK